Output 09def14b51d1dddc808729a3c1de74bdc5d2d8c7f68f1f7fb6672e83f592daab:0

value
107807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 763f9d7b288c2fc9fba3e71d7f0e34c227aa7d5f OP_EQUAL
address
3CUFsEnrAwzVgbizvBNstAfZmMUE6RKQPc
transaction
09def14b51d1dddc808729a3c1de74bdc5d2d8c7f68f1f7fb6672e83f592daab
confirmations
308444
spent
true